【英语毕业演讲稿】Good morning, everyone.
It is with a mix of excitement and nostalgia that I stand before you today. As we gather here on this special day, I can’t help but reflect on the journey that has brought us to this moment. Four years ago, we were strangers, each carrying our own dreams and uncertainties. Today, we are not just classmates, but friends, mentors, and future leaders in our own right.
Graduation is more than just a ceremony; it is a celebration of growth, resilience, and the power of learning. Throughout these years, we have faced challenges—late-night study sessions, difficult exams, and moments of self-doubt. But through it all, we have learned to push forward, to believe in ourselves, and to support one another.
One of the most valuable lessons I’ve learned is that education is not just about textbooks and grades. It’s about curiosity, critical thinking, and the ability to connect with others. Every conversation, every debate, and every project has shaped who we are today. We have discovered new passions, developed new skills, and grown into more confident individuals.
As we move forward, I encourage each of you to carry the spirit of this university with you. Let us continue to learn, to lead, and to make a difference in the world. The future may be uncertain, but it is also full of possibilities. We have the tools, the knowledge, and the support to succeed.
To my classmates, I say thank you. Thank you for being part of this incredible journey. To my teachers and mentors, I express my deepest gratitude for your guidance and inspiration. And to my family and friends, I am truly grateful for your love and encouragement throughout the years.
As we step into the next chapter of our lives, let us remember that we are not just graduates—we are dreamers, thinkers, and changemakers. The world needs people like us, and I have no doubt that we will make a lasting impact.
Thank you, and congratulations to all of us on this unforgettable achievement.
